The Pistons may have beaten the Oklahoma City Thunder 104-88 in Detroit last night, but it was Pistons guard Kentavious Caldwell-Pope who took an actual beating.

Take a look as Russell Westbrook takes a shot and as Caldwell-Pope reaches in to try to disrupt his rhythm, realizes Westbrook is taking two shots.

One, sending the ball to the rim, the other, a kick to Pope's most sensitive of areas.
